Skip to content

[feature] Implement EXPath Binary Module 4.0

6be0282
Select commit
Loading
Failed to load commit list.
Closed

Implement EXPath Binary Module 4.0 #6101

[feature] Implement EXPath Binary Module 4.0
6be0282
Select commit
Loading
Failed to load commit list.
Codacy Production / Codacy Static Code Analysis required action Mar 6, 2026 in 0s

1 new issue (0 max.) of at least severity.

Codacy Here is an overview of what got changed by this pull request:

Issues
======
- Added 1
           

Complexity increasing per file
==============================
- extensions/expath/src/test/java/org/expath/exist/BinaryModuleTest.java  87
- extensions/expath/src/main/java/org/expath/exist/BinaryTextFunctions.java  23
- extensions/expath/src/main/java/org/expath/exist/BinaryModule.java  5
- extensions/expath/src/main/java/org/expath/exist/BinaryBasicFunctions.java  48
- extensions/expath/src/main/java/org/expath/exist/BinaryModuleErrorCode.java  1
- extensions/expath/src/main/java/org/expath/exist/BinaryConversionFunctions.java  47
- extensions/expath/src/main/java/org/expath/exist/BinaryModuleHelper.java  14
- extensions/expath/src/main/java/org/expath/exist/BinaryPackingFunctions.java  37
- extensions/expath/src/main/java/org/expath/exist/BinaryBitwiseFunctions.java  23
         

Clones added
============
- extensions/expath/src/test/java/org/expath/exist/BinaryModuleTest.java  1
- extensions/expath/src/main/java/org/expath/exist/BinaryTextFunctions.java  9
- extensions/expath/src/main/java/org/expath/exist/BinaryModule.java  1
- extensions/expath/src/main/java/org/expath/exist/BinaryBasicFunctions.java  9
- extensions/expath/src/main/java/org/expath/exist/BinaryConversionFunctions.java  1
- extensions/expath/src/main/java/org/expath/exist/BinaryPackingFunctions.java  9
- extensions/expath/src/main/java/org/expath/exist/BinaryBitwiseFunctions.java  3
         

See the complete overview on Codacy

Annotations

Check warning on line 321 in extensions/expath/src/main/java/org/expath/exist/BinaryBasicFunctions.java

See this annotation in the file changed.

@codacy-production codacy-production / Codacy Static Code Analysis

extensions/expath/src/main/java/org/expath/exist/BinaryBasicFunctions.java#L321

Avoid using a branching statement as the last in a loop.